affect usefulness
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"affect usefulness"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ing how something influences or changes the effectiveness or utility of an object, idea, or process. Example: "The new software update may affect usefulness by improving performance and adding new features."

Which is correct, "affect usefulness" or "effect usefulness"?
"Affect" is typically used as a verb meaning to influence, while "effect" is often a noun meaning a result. Therefore, "affect usefulness" is generally correct when describing how something influences utility.
